Title: “The Rise of Military Drones: Transforming Modern Warfare” Article: In recent years, the use of military drones has surged to the forefront as a pivotal technology in modern warfare. These unmanned aerial vehicles, commonly known as drones, have revolutionized military operations by offering unparalleled surveillance, precision strikes, and reconnaissance capabilities. The integration of drones into military strategies has not only transformed the nature of warfare but also raised ethical and legal concerns in the international community. One of the key advantages of military drones is their ability to conduct long-duration reconnaissance missions over hostile territories without putting human lives at risk. Equipped with high-resolution cameras and sensors, drones provide real-time intelligence to military commanders, allowing for better decision-making in tactical operations. Moreover, their precision strike capabilities have been proven effective in targeting high-value enemy assets with minimal collateral damage. The proliferation of military drones has also led to concerns about the ethical implications of remote warfare. Critics argue that the use of drones can lead to a dehumanization of conflict, as operators are detached from the physical realities of war. Moreover, the legality of drone strikes in sovereign territories, such as targeted assassinations, has sparked debates on international law and the boundaries of state sovereignty. Despite the controversies surrounding their use, military drones have become an integral tool for military forces worldwide. The development of advanced drone technologies, such as stealth capabilities and autonomous navigation, is expected to further enhance their effectiveness on the battlefield. As nations continue to invest in drone research and development, the future of warfare is likely to be dominated by unmanned aerial systems. In conclusion, the rise of military drones signifies a paradigm shift in modern warfare, with implications for strategy, ethics, and international law. While their use offers significant advantages in terms of surveillance and precision strikes, it also poses challenges in terms of accountability and oversight. As the technology continues to evolve, the ethical and legal frameworks governing drone warfare will need to adapt to ensure responsible and transparent military operations.

Title: “The Rise of Military Drones: Revolutionizing Modern Warfare”

Introduction:
Military drones, also known as unmanned aerial vehicles (UAVs), have emerged as a game-changer in modern warfare. These aerial vehicles, once exclusively associated with surveillance missions, now play a crucial role in combat operations across the globe. From traditional reconnaissance drones to cutting-edge flying wing UAVs, the evolution of military drones has revolutionized the way nations conduct warfare.

The Evolution of Military Drones:
The history of military drones can be traced back to the early 20th century when experimental prototypes were first developed for military reconnaissance purposes. Over the decades, advancements in technology have led to the development of sophisticated UAVs capable of carrying out a wide range of missions. Today, UAV factories churn out drones of all shapes and sizes, from small target drones used for training purposes to large, long-endurance aircraft like the flying wing UAVs deployed in combat zones.

Types of Military Drones:
Military drones come in various shapes and sizes, each designed for specific mission objectives. Reconnaissance drones, equipped with high-definition cameras and sensors, provide real-time intelligence to military commanders. Combat drones, armed with precision-guided munitions, can strike targets with unparalleled accuracy. Surveillance drones, such as the Aofun UAV, are used for monitoring enemy movements and activities in hostile environments.

Benefits of Military Drones:
The use of military drones offers several advantages to modern warfare. By eliminating the need for human pilots, drones reduce the risk to military personnel and minimize casualties in combat zones. Their ability to loiter over target areas for extended periods allows for persistent surveillance and timely strike capabilities. Moreover, drones can reach remote or dangerous locations that may be inaccessible to manned aircraft, making them invaluable assets in military operations.

Challenges and Controversies:
Despite their benefits, military drones are not without controversy. The use of drones in targeted killings has raised ethical concerns about the legality and morality of such operations. Reports of civilian casualties resulting from drone strikes have sparked debates over the proportionality and collateral damage of these attacks. Furthermore, questions about the violation of national sovereignty in drone operations conducted in foreign territories continue to be a contentious issue.

Future Trends in Military Drone Technology:
Looking ahead, the future of military drone technology promises even greater advancements. Artificial intelligence will enable drones to operate autonomously and make split-second decisions on the battlefield. Swarming capabilities will allow multiple drones to coordinate their actions and overwhelm enemy defenses. The integration of advanced sensors and stealth technologies will enhance the survivability and effectiveness of military drones in high-threat environments.

Conclusion:
In conclusion, the rise of military drones has truly revolutionized modern warfare. These versatile aerial platforms have reshaped the dynamics of military operations, offering new capabilities and challenges to military forces around the world. As technology continues to evolve, the role of military drones in future conflicts is set to expand, shaping the face of warfare in the 21st century and beyond.
